The Importance of IP Addresses

Before we dive into the nitty-gritty of finding the IP address of a network drive, it’s essential to understand the significance of IP addresses. An IP address (Internet Protocol address) is a unique numerical label assigned to each device connected to a computer network. It allows devices to communicate with each other and facilitates data transmission over the internet. Without an IP address, a device would be unable to connect to a network, making it impossible to access files, printers, or any other network resources.

In the context of a network drive, the IP address serves as a unique identifier, enabling your device to locate and connect to the drive. Think of it as a digital address that helps your device navigate to the network drive and access its contents.

Method 5: Check Your Router’s Configuration

Another approach is to check your router’s configuration to find the IP address of the network drive.

Access Your Router’s Web Interface

Open a web browser and type the IP address of your router (usually 192.168.0.1 or 192.168.1.1). You may need to consult your router’s documentation or contact your internet service provider for the exact IP address.

Check the Attached Devices List

Once you’ve accessed the router’s web interface, navigate to the “Attached Devices” or “Connected Devices” list. This list should display all devices connected to your router, including the network drive.

Look for the IP Address

Find the network drive in the list and look for its IP address. You may need to click on the device name or IP address to access its details.

How do I find the IP address of my network drive?

There are several ways to find the IP address of a network drive, depending on the type of drive and its configuration. One common method is to check the drive’s documentation or manufacturer’s website for instructions on finding the IP address. Another method is to use the Command Prompt or Terminal on a computer connected to the same network as the drive. The command “arp -a” can be used to display a list of connected devices, including the network drive and its IP address.

Alternatively, users can also check the router’s configuration page to see a list of connected devices and their IP addresses. The exact steps may vary depending on the router model and manufacturer, but generally, users can access the configuration page by typing the router’s IP address in a web browser and logging in with admin credentials.

What is the difference between a static and dynamic IP address?

A static IP address is a fixed IP address assigned to a device or network drive, whereas a dynamic IP address is a temporary IP address assigned by the router or DHCP server. Static IP addresses are typically used for devices that need to be accessed remotely or require a fixed address for configuration purposes. Dynamic IP addresses, on the other hand, are assigned automatically by the router and can change each time the device connects to the network.

In the context of a network drive, a static IP address can be useful for configuring remote access or port forwarding rules. However, dynamic IP addresses are more common and can be sufficient for most uses. If the network drive is assigned a dynamic IP address, it may be necessary to use a service like Dynamic DNS to keep track of the changing IP address and ensure remote access is maintained.

How do I access my network drive using its IP address?

To access a network drive using its IP address, users can map the drive to their computer or device. This involves creating a new network location and entering the IP address of the drive. The exact steps may vary depending on the operating system and device being used, but generally, users can follow these steps: open File Explorer or Finder, click on “Map network drive” or “Connect to server”, enter the IP address of the drive, and select the drive letter or mount point.

Once the drive is mapped, users can access its contents as if it were a local drive. They can browse files and folders, copy and move files, and perform other tasks as needed. Note that users may need to enter authentication credentials, such as a username and password, to access the drive depending on the drive’s configuration and security settings.
